Your vehicle's safety is dependent on the glass you put on your windshield. If you notice damage to your windshield, it is important to repair it as soon as you can. A chip or crack could make driving difficult , and it could cause other issues, such as a rise in usage of fuel or loss of vision.

A chip is the most common kind of damage to windshields. This occurs when a stone, or another hard object, hits the windshield and splits an area. It is usually repaired quickly, but it is possible to replace the entire windshield in severe instances.

This is particularly relevant for windscreen replacements where the technician will require the entire windscreen to be removed and replaced in a single step.

A specific primer agent will then be applied to the windscreen's frame. Then, a bonding glue will also be used before the windscreen is set. This will ensure that the new glass will have a solid hold and won't be pulled away after the adhesive has dried.

The UK law requires that the MOT tests be performed on all vehicles.  lens replacement basildon  tests your car's roadworthiness and exhaust emissions and other aspects of its health. It covers all kinds of vehicles, from small motorbikes to large lorries.

This test is designed to ensure that your car meets environmental and road standards. It can also save you money in long-term. It is an official requirement in the UK for vehicles older than three years.

Unless you have an exempt vehicle or are covered under an insurance plan, your MOT should be checked every year. You should also make an appointment for your MOT in advance, so that you have plenty of time to repair any issues.

There are a myriad of reasons your vehicle may fail an MOT test. The most frequent ones can be cured quickly, saving you money on repairs. If you do discover something you'd like to repair it's best to take it to a local garage so that they can examine the problem for themselves.

A cracked windshield can lead to your MOT failing. It's important to ensure that it will be repaired prior to the date of the test. The windscreen is in your driver's line-of-sight during the test, and any damage that is greater than 40mm on it could cause an MOT to fail.

Window Repairs

Window repairs are essential for maintaining the appearance of your home and functionality. By stopping air from getting into or out of your home, they will help you save money and cut down on your monthly expenses.


The cost of a window replacement will depend on the extent of damage as well as the type of glass that is being replaced. The average cost of repairing a window is typically less than replacing the entire window.

A window's frame, sash, seals, and glass form all play a part in the overall repair or replacement cost. Most of the time, a sash can be removed and replaced with a new one to reduce the number of replacement panes.

Epoxy wood filler is used to fix a window with a decaying sill or frame. However, if the rot is severe or extends to the inside of the casings then you'll probably need to replace it entirely.

Water infiltration around the window is another indicator that the casing is getting deteriorated. If your exterior casing has been rusted, you should replace it with fresh, primed wood from your local home center.

A sash that isn't able to be raised or lowered is one of the most frequently encountered issues with windows. This is caused by several things, including multiple layers of paint that are bridging the frame and sash, or broken cords on the sash weights.

The sashes of springs can also become damaged or damaged, making it difficult to raise and lower. A drip cap on the top of the window is a simple fix for the majority of DIYers. an aluminum drip cap can be bought from most home stores and then nailed in place and caulked.

If you have fake muntins and mullions that are not real, they can be replaced by real wood. If you're not able to find a piece that matches the original wood, a window repair professional can cut new muntins and mullions for you.
